'''Erling Bjarne Johnson''' (7 June 1893 – 5 November 1967) invented the [nitrophosphate process](/source/nitrophosphate_process) in the years 1927-28. The process is recognised internationally as important in the production of [fertiliser](/source/fertiliser), but he is little-known in his native Norway.

Johnson worked as a chemical engineer, graduating from Kristiania Tekniske Skole ("Kristiania School of Technics") in 1913. He continued his amanuensis at the chemical institute of the [Norwegian University of Life Sciences](/source/Norwegian_University_of_Life_Sciences) from 1913 to 1916, where he was assistant to Professor Sebelien. His work concentrated on questions around fertilisers.

He worked as a research chemist for the [North Western Cyanamide Company](/source/North_Western_Cyanamide_Company) in [Odda](/source/Odda_(town)) from 1915 to 1921, where he also worked on fertilisers. He sat on the State Raw Materials Committee in 1921. He was chemical and technical lead for A/S Monopol paint factory in [Florvåg](/source/Florv%C3%A5g) on [Askøy Municipality](/source/Ask%C3%B8y_Municipality), near [Bergen](/source/Bergen_(city)), at the same time as working with Jakobsens Fabrikker A/S in [Oslo](/source/Oslo) from 1921 to 1924. He was head chemist at [Odda Smelteverk](/source/Odda_Smelteverk) A/S from 1925. Johnson was one of the foremost chemists at Odda Smelteverk. He worked there until 1963, when he retired.

In 1964, Johnson was awarded the [Guldberg og Waage-medaljen](/source/Guldberg_og_Waage-medaljen) by the [Norwegian Chemical Society](/source/Norwegian_Chemical_Society).
